Appreciation of the original text: Liu Xiang's Shuo Yuan and Xin Xu belong to a collection of historical stories.

"Shuo Yuan ***20 Volumes" revolves around 20 central ideas and carries out moral preaching and political exhortation by quoting stories. Discuss with more reference to Confucianism and clarify the reasons for the rise and fall of the country and the success or failure of politics for reference. This book preserves a large number of ancient books in the pre-Qin period, which can make up for the lack of history. The style is close to the novel, the idea is ironic, and the content is lively, which has a certain influence on later novels and folk literature creation.

The New Preface combs the activities and comments of historical figures from pre-Qin to Western Han Dynasty.

It is also a historical story to persuade the monarch, the minister and the people to save the current abuses and govern the people.

A *** 10 volume is divided into five volumes of Miscellaneous Work, 1 volume of Pricking Luxury, two volumes of Jieshi and two volumes of Good Ideas. Although the historical stories quoted are different from Zuo Zhuan and Historical Records, they are concise in wording, vivid in language and thorough in discussion. In addition, a large number of anecdotes were collected, which enabled many ancient books to be preserved.

About the author:

Liu Xiang (77- 6 BC) was a scholar, bibliographer and writer in the Western Han Dynasty. The real name has been changed and the word is correct. He was born in Pei County, Jiangsu Province. The fourth grandson of Wang () in the early Han Dynasty. The biography of Gu Liang in the Spring and Autumn Period. He used to be an exhortation doctor and Zong Zheng. Political affairs are accompanied by yin and yang disasters, and many letters have been written to illegally exert the exclusive rights of consorts. When he became emperor, he was appointed as Doctor Guanglu and eventually became the captain of Zhong Lei. He reviewed the Royal Library and wrote China's earliest bibliography, Bielu.

He wrote 33 pieces of ci and fu, including Nine Sighs, most of which have been lost. The original collection has been lost, which was compiled by Liu in Ming Dynasty. His other works, Biography of Hong Fan's Five Elements, New Preface, Shuoyuan and Biography of Lienv, still exist today. And the Five Classics Yi Tong, also lost.
